There are many ways banks in Monument, CO make a profit. One way is by charging fees for services like checking and savings accounts, loans, and mortgages. Another way is by investing the money deposited by customers into certificates of deposit (CDs) or other types of investments. And finally, banks can make a profit by lending money to people and businesses at a higher interest rate than they paid for the loan.
